Bed Bug Control

Having bed bugs in your beds, sofa, or rugs can be uncomfortable and unpleasant. Bed bugs feed using a stylet, a mouthpart that pierces our skin to obtain blood. They can leave red, swelling bite marks on your skin. Some people may encounter skin disease or rashes when bitten, depending on how sensitive your skin is. Brown Recluse Removal & Extermination

In most cases, the Brown Recluse you’ll find in Atoka, TN isn’t very large. Usually, the brown recluse measures between 0.5–1 inch in size. It can be identified by its noticeable brown color and the black line running down its back. It’s often said that this stripe resembles the shape of a fiddle, which is why the brown recluse is often called the brown fiddler.
